PGMA and FG: Not Guilty in ZTE Deal


Together with complaints against the officials of ZTE namely Lorenzo Formoso, Elmer Soneja, Yu Yong, George Zhuying, Fan Yan, and Hou Wei, President Gloria Macapagal-Arroyo and her husband First Gentleman Jose Miguel Arroyo were dismissed yesterday. Also cleared in the case were Jose "Joey" de Venecia and Transportation Secretary Leandro Mendoza.

But the Office of the Ombudsman charged former elections chief Benjamin Abalos and Social Security System president Romulo Neri guilty.Cases of violation of Republic Act 3019 or the Anti-Graft and Corrupt Practices Act will be filed against Abalos and Neri before the Sandiganbayan. Where also a separate case for “corruption of public officials,” or a violation of Article 212 of the Revised Penal Code, was likewise recommended against Abalos, which will be lodged before the Metropolitan Trial Court of Mandaluyong City.

A 144-page joint resolution was dated April 21, 2009 but was approved only on Aug. 27 by overall deputy ombudsman Orlando Casimiro. was signed by Emilio Gonzales III, deputy ombudsman for the military and other law enforcement offices; Robert Kallos, deputy special prosecutor; Rodolfo Elman, assistant ombudsman; Cesar Asuncion, director; and Jesus Micael, special prosecutor. where ombudsman Merceditas Gutierrez, a law school classmate of Mr. Arroyo, inhibited from the case. The ruling came two years after businessman Jose de Venecia III, son and namesake of the former House speaker, exposed the alleged anomalies in the deal and implicated the First Gentleman and Abalos.

Why is Mr. Arroyo, De Venecia and Mendoza were cleared? It is because “due to lack of probable cause.” While President Arroyo was not indicted because she is immune from suits as incumbent president.

The Akbayan party list (which file the case) member Rep. Risa Hontiveros-Baraquel said that with the ruling, they are now urging Abalos and Neri to “speak up” and reveal everything they know about the NBN-ZTE deal.

Mr. Arroyo’s lawyer said he was “pleasantly surprised” by the Ombudsman ruling. “We’ve always been confident. They failed to show any evidence or proof (of Mr. Arroyo’s involvement) and we’ve properly presented our factual and legal defense,” Ruy Rondain told The STAR over the phone.

“I maintain my innocence. I have nothing to do with the pricing (of ZTE project),” Abalos said. Where he resigned from the Comelec on Oct. 1, 2007 amid accusations by the younger De Venecia that he had tried to broker the $329-million NBN project. That is, according to Abalos the accusations of De Venecia were baseless and should not be given any weight. “He was claiming that I was brokering for the project. But he was the one who kept on coming to Wack Wack (golf club). Kung ako may kailangan sa kanya, bakit sya ang punta ng punta sa akin (If I’m the one who needed something from him, then why is it that it was he who kept on coming to me)?” he asked.

Neri had testified before the Senate about an apparent attempt by Abalos to bribe him to convince him to endorse the project. Neri was then socioeconomic secretary when Abalos made the alleged bribe offer. "The Ombudsman filed criminal charges against me?” Neri asked, almost incredulously.
